Steering Pull Adjustment
Thesteering onsomeboats willhavethe tendencytopull towards starboard. Thispulling
condition can be corrected by using a pliers and bending the ends of the exhaustfins (a)
1/16 in. (1.5 mm) toward the starboard side of the outboard.

Impeller Clearance Adjustment
1. The impeller should be adjusted so there is approximately 0.030 in. (0.8 mm) clear-
ance between the impeller edge and liner. Operatingthe jet drivein waters thatcon-
tain sand and gravel can cause wear to the impeller blades, and the clearance will
start to exceed 0.030in. (0.8 mm). Asthe blades wear, shims (a)located in thestack
outside of the impeller can be transferred behind the impeller. This will move the im-
peller further down into the tapered liner to reduce the clearance.
2. Check the impeller clearance by sliding a feeler gauge through the intake grate and
measuretheclearancebetweentheimpelleredgeandliner.Ifadjustmentisrequired,
refer to Impeller Removal and Installation.
